== English ==
=== Etymology ===
Named after German physical trainer Joseph Pilates.
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/pɪˈlɑːtiːz/
=== Noun ===
Pilates (uncountable)
A physical fitness system developed in the early 20th century by Joseph Pilates.
==== Synonyms ====
Contrology

== German ==
=== Etymology ===
Probably a variant of Pilatus, which occurs as an (also rare, but slightly more common) surname.
=== Pronunciation ===
IPA(key): /piˈlaːtəs/, (seldom also) /piˈlaːteːs/
